在信息化快速发展的今天,网络安全显得尤为重要。而数据包分析作为网络安全中的一项基础技能,得到了越来越多专业人士的关注。通过对网络数据包的分析,能够有效识别网络流量中的异常活动,从而从源头上阻止潜在的安全威胁。无论是网络管理员、信息安全专家,还是开发人员,都需要掌握一定的数据包分析技术,以提高网络的安全性和稳定性。

数据包分析的基本概念是理解网络通信的结构。每个数据包通常由头部和负载两部分组成,头部包含了关于数据包来源、目的地和协议类型等信息,而负载部分则是传输的数据内容。要有效分析数据包,首先需要一个合适的工具,例如Wireshark。Wireshark是一款广泛使用的网络协议分析工具,可以捕捉、查看和分析网络流量。
学习如何使用Wireshark时,首先需要安装并配置软件。打开Wireshark后,通过选择相应的网络接口开始捕获数据包。在数据包捕获过程中,用户可以实时查看到网络流量的信息,包括源IP、目的IP、协议类型及其数据长度等。通过对这些信息的分析,便可以判断当前网络的运行状态及潜在的网络问题。
为了更深入地分析数据包,了解各类协议的工作原理也非常重要。例如,TCP协议负责保证数据的可靠传输,而UDP协议则用于需要快速传输的场景。识别各种协议能够帮助分析者快速定位问题,并采取相应的解决措施。
在数据包分析过程中,常见的分析技巧包括过滤数据、跟踪TCP流以及使用统计功能。通过设置不同的过滤器,分析者可以只查看感兴趣的流量,减少信息的干扰。利用TCP流跟踪功能,能够更清晰地了解数据传输的全过程。Wireshark的统计功能提供了流量图和协议分布等可视化信息,帮助分析者从总体上把握网络的状态。
数据包分析不仅是技术工作,还是对各种网络攻击手段的防范。通过数据包分析,网络管理员能够及时发现并响应DDoS攻击、数据泄露等安全事件,从而保护组织的网络资源和信息安全。掌握数据包分析的基本知识,对提升整体网络安全素养至关重要。
提高数据包分析能力是保障网络安全的重要步骤。无论是从事网络管理的人员还是信息安全的专业人士,都应该重视这一技能的学习和实践。在未来,随着网络环境的不断变化,数据包分析的技术也将不断演进,专业人士需要时刻跟进最新的技术动态,以保持竞争力和应对能力。
